I figured it out for real this time.
The problem I was having was IK changed some of the default keyswitches in MODO BASS 2 from what they were in MODO BASS 1.5, including the A-string (it was A0 in MODO BASS 1.5).
I was using a keyswitch map for MODO BASS 1.5, so it was sending FORCE A STRING to A0 instead of A-1.
This is that "can of worms that eventually leads to trouble and confusion down the line" I was talking about when you change keyswitch defaults!

Well, I hate to be a bother, but I have come across 2 other issues...
1) MODO BASS occasionally ignores the FORCE STRING keyswitch.
This problem sounds a lot like the problem I was having before, and in fact, it was one of the symptoms I was experiencing. But as it turns out, even with the keyswitch map updated for MODO BASS 2, I am still getting occasional notes played on the wrong string with FORCE STRING applied correctly. It happens only occasionally, and seemingly randomly. I can duplicate a part 10 times, and it might switch to the wrong string once during playback. Play it again, and it might happen again in a different spot, or not at all. So as it turns out, the previous problem I encountered is not completely resolved after all.
2) RIGHT HAND POSITION isn't retained separately for FINGER, PICK, SLAP.
In MODO BASS 1.5, it would remember that your FINGER position is 3.20 and your pick position is 1.90. Switch between FINGER and PICK, and the RIGHT HAND POSITION changes to the correct position. But in MODO BASS 2, the position stays where it is.

The keymap I created doesn't transform the note (though it can). All it is doing is telling Studio One that A-1 is "A String" and E-1 is "E String." Those keys are highlighted in the piano roll and rolling over them says what they do. You can also "convert Keyswitches to Sound Variations" which removes the keyswitch notes from the piano roll and places them in a special Sound Variations lane. If you update the trigger note in the keyswitch map, it automatically changes all of those Sound Variation keyswitches to the new note.jbraner wrote: Thu Jun 02, 2022 8:21 pmAre you sure it's not a problem with the keymap?
